asthma due to air pollution in Granada

Low Chances of Asthma

Asthma

Risk of Asthma symptoms is Low when AQI is Good (0-50)

Mild symptoms such as slight wheezing, occasional cough, and minor shortness of breath

Do's :

  • Keep track of air quality to plan outdoor activities safely.

  • Drink water to keep airways moist and reduce irritation.

  • Include non-allergenic fruits and vegetables that support overall lung health, like apples, pears, and spinach.

Don'ts :

  • Skip medications that is prescribed by your doctor.

  • Engage in outdoor activities in early morning during high pollen hours.
